TxmlParser Class

Represents type TxmlParser.

Namespace: flcXMLParser
TObject
  flcXMLParser.TxmlParser
type
 TxmlParser = class
 end;

The TxmlParser type exposes the following members.

Show:
 NameDescription
Create

Initializes a new instance of the TxmlParser class.

Destroy

Represents the destructor of the TxmlParser class.

Top
Show:
 NameDescription
Encoding

Represents property Encoding.

Options

Represents property Options.

Top
Show:
 NameDescription
Clear

Represents method Clear.

CreateAttribute(UnicodeString,TxmlAttValue)

Represents method CreateAttribute(UnicodeString,TxmlAttValue).

CreateAttributeList(UnicodeString,TxmlTypeList)

Represents method CreateAttributeList(UnicodeString,TxmlTypeList).

CreateCharData(UnicodeString)

Represents method CreateCharData(UnicodeString).

CreateCharRef(Word32,Boolean)

Represents method CreateCharRef(Word32,Boolean).

CreateComment(UnicodeString)

Represents method CreateComment(UnicodeString).

CreateDocTypeDeclarationList

Represents method CreateDocTypeDeclarationList.

CreateDocument(TxmlProlog,AxmlElement)

Represents method CreateDocument(TxmlProlog,AxmlElement).

CreateElement(TxmlStartTag,TxmlEndTag,TxmlElementContent)

Represents method CreateElement(TxmlStartTag,TxmlEndTag,TxmlElementContent).

CreateElementContent(TxmlStartTag)

Represents method CreateElementContent(TxmlStartTag).

CreateEmptyElement(TxmlEmptyElementTag)

Represents method CreateEmptyElement(TxmlEmptyElementTag).

CreateEmptyElementTag(UnicodeString,AxmlAttributeList)

Represents method CreateEmptyElementTag(UnicodeString,AxmlAttributeList).

CreateEndTag(UnicodeString)

Represents method CreateEndTag(UnicodeString).

CreateGeneralEntityRef(UnicodeString)

Represents method CreateGeneralEntityRef(UnicodeString).

CreatePEReference(UnicodeString)

Represents method CreatePEReference(UnicodeString).

CreateProcessingInstruction(UnicodeString,UnicodeString)

Represents method CreateProcessingInstruction(UnicodeString,UnicodeString).

CreateStartTag(UnicodeString,AxmlAttributeList)

Represents method CreateStartTag(UnicodeString,AxmlAttributeList).

CreateTextAttribute(UnicodeString,TxmlQuotedText)

Represents method CreateTextAttribute(UnicodeString,TxmlQuotedText).

ExpectChar(WideChar)

Represents method ExpectChar(WideChar).

ExpectRawByteStr(RawByteString)

Represents method ExpectRawByteStr(RawByteString).

ExtractAttDef

Represents method ExtractAttDef.

ExtractAttDefList(TxmlTypeList)

Represents method ExtractAttDefList(TxmlTypeList).

ExtractAttListDeclaration

Represents method ExtractAttListDeclaration.

ExtractAttribute

Represents method ExtractAttribute.

ExtractAttributeList(UnicodeString)

Represents method ExtractAttributeList(UnicodeString).

ExtractAttributeValue

Represents method ExtractAttributeValue.

ExtractCDATASection

Represents method ExtractCDATASection.

ExtractCharRef

Represents method ExtractCharRef.

ExtractComment

Represents method ExtractComment.

ExtractDeclarations

Represents method ExtractDeclarations.

ExtractDocument

Represents method ExtractDocument.

ExtractDTD

Represents method ExtractDTD.

ExtractElementDeclaration

Represents method ExtractElementDeclaration.

ExtractEntityDeclaration

Represents method ExtractEntityDeclaration.

ExtractEntityRef

Represents method ExtractEntityRef.

ExtractEq(Boolean)

Represents method ExtractEq(Boolean).

ExtractETag

Represents method ExtractETag.

ExtractExternalID(Boolean,Boolean)

Represents method ExtractExternalID(Boolean,Boolean).

ExtractMarkupDeclaration

Represents method ExtractMarkupDeclaration.

ExtractName(Boolean)

Represents method ExtractName(Boolean).

ExtractNames(TxmlTypeList,Boolean,AnsiChar)

Represents method ExtractNames(TxmlTypeList,Boolean,AnsiChar).

ExtractNamesRest(TxmlTypeList,Boolean,AnsiChar)

Represents method ExtractNamesRest(TxmlTypeList,Boolean,AnsiChar).

ExtractNmToken(Boolean)

Represents method ExtractNmToken(Boolean).

ExtractNotationDeclaration

Represents method ExtractNotationDeclaration.

ExtractPEReference

Represents method ExtractPEReference.

ExtractProcessingInstruction

Represents method ExtractProcessingInstruction.

ExtractQTag

Represents method ExtractQTag.

ExtractQuote(WideChar)

Represents method ExtractQuote(WideChar).

ExtractQuotedReferenceText(CxmlQuotedReferenceText,ByteCharSet,Boolean)

Represents method ExtractQuotedReferenceText(CxmlQuotedReferenceText,ByteCharSet,Boolean).

ExtractQuotedText(ByteCharSet)

Represents method ExtractQuotedText(ByteCharSet).

ExtractQuotedTextString(WideChar,ByteCharSet)

Represents method ExtractQuotedTextString(WideChar,ByteCharSet).

ExtractReference

Represents method ExtractReference.

ExtractReferenceText(TxmlTypeList,ByteCharSet,Boolean)

Represents method ExtractReferenceText(TxmlTypeList,ByteCharSet,Boolean).

ExtractTag

Represents method ExtractTag.

ExtractText(ByteCharSet)

Represents method ExtractText(ByteCharSet).

ExtractTextAttribute

Represents method ExtractTextAttribute.

ExtractTextString(ByteCharSet)

Represents method ExtractTextString(ByteCharSet).

ExtractXMLDeclaration

Represents method ExtractXMLDeclaration.

GetCheckWellFormed

Represents method GetCheckWellFormed.

GetNextToken

Represents method GetNextToken.

Init

Represents method Init.

MatchSpace

Represents method MatchSpace.

MatchSpaceDelimited(RawByteString,Boolean)

Represents method MatchSpaceDelimited(RawByteString,Boolean).

ParseElement

Represents method ParseElement.

ParseError(String)

Represents method ParseError(String).

ParseProlog

Represents method ParseProlog.

SetBuffer(Pointer,Integer)

Represents method SetBuffer(Pointer,Integer).

SetFileName(String)

Represents method SetFileName(String).

SetReader(AReaderEx,Boolean)

Represents method SetReader(AReaderEx,Boolean).

SetStringB(RawByteString)

Represents method SetStringB(RawByteString).

SetUnicodeReader(TUnicodeReader,Boolean)

Represents method SetUnicodeReader(TUnicodeReader,Boolean).

SkipSpace

Represents method SkipSpace.

Top
Show:
 NameDescription
OnComment

Represents property OnComment.

OnElement

Represents property OnElement.

OnPI

Represents property OnPI.

OnTag

Represents property OnTag.

Top
Show:
 NameDescription
FEncoding

Represents field FEncoding.

FOnComment

Represents field FOnComment.

FOnElement

Represents field FOnElement.

FOnPI

Represents field FOnPI.

FOnTag

Represents field FOnTag.

FOptions

Represents field FOptions.

FRawReader

Represents field FRawReader.

FRawReaderOwner

Represents field FRawReaderOwner.

FRawString

Represents field FRawString.

FReader

Represents field FReader.

FReaderOwner

Represents field FReaderOwner.

FToken

Represents field FToken.

Top